Kolkata: The Centralised Admission Portal (CAP), which was scheduled to start on Monday evening, has been delayed. Though the official order stated that the portal would start functioning on Monday evening, several students who attempted to apply after the announcement could not access it.
The undergraduate admission portal of Presidency University, which was also scheduled to open on Monday, did not go live due to "technical problemss." Students can submit applications from Tuesday evening onwards until June 1. Chemistry, statistics, life sciences, political science, history and economics will admit students solely on the basis of admission tests which will be conducted between June 12 and 14.
Jadavpur University will open its undergraduate admission portal on Wednesday. Registrar Selim Box Mandal said, "Our admission portal for UG admissions shall go live by Wednesday evening." The entrance tests for science subjects will be held between June 23 and 25, while the admission tests for arts subjects will be conducted between June 25 and July 3.
A higher education dept official said, "The portal was tested many times, and technical errors, if any, were fixed.
We are hopeful that students will not face any trouble while applying."
Rupkatha, who passed HS and wants to study at Lady Brabourne College, checked several times to submit her application but failed. Abhishikta Dan from Burdwan said, "I still do not have access to the portal. It said it would open in the evening, but I couldn't access it even late at night."
